Diplocaulus magnicornis Stegodon numerous finds have allowed scientistsDiplocaulus magnicornis was a unique lepospondyl amphibian that lived during the Early Permian , about 270 million years ago, in what is now North America. Its most striking feature was the shape of its skull: wide and flattened, with boomerang shaped lateral projections that gave it a unique and easily recognizable appearance.
